    Samsung Foundry’s disappointing run of 3nm yields continues, as the company has yet again failed to meet expectations for its SF3 process node. Despite being one of the earliest to mass-produce 3nm chips, Samsung has struggled to achieve competitive yields for nearly three years now. According to South Korean outlet Chosun Biz, Samsung’s 3nm yields are hovering around 50% for its 3nm process.

    For the past year or so, Honor’s marketing strategy has consistently revolved around comparing itself to Samsung. The company has used the Korean tech giant as a benchmark, even going so far as to engrave a 166-word ‘mock’ statement on the hinge of the Honor V3. Now, as part of the marketing campaign for its new Honor 400 series, the company has essentially “mocked” Samsung for keeping a consistent design face for its Galaxy lineup.

    Windows has shipped with native ZIP support since Windows XP (2001). However, native support for additional formats such as RAR, 7-Zip, and TAR only arrived in Windows 11 Insider Build 23466/23H2 via the open-source libarchive library.
